Karen O Goes Wild!

The Yeah Yeah Yeahs released a new album earlier this year, but that doesn't mean singer Karen O is through with her creative output for the year. She's working with composer Carter Burwell and others on helping craft the score to Spike Jonze's Where the Wild Things Are. A sample of her music can be heard in the film teaser below that was shown recently at Comic-Con.

The NYC rocker has worked on films before, such as Jackass 2 and I'm Not There, but her work on Wild Things involves working on the score itself, not merely recording a song for the soundtrack. Her collaborator, Burwell, is known for doing nearly all the Coen Brothers films as well as Twilight, Hamlet and others. The film itself, currently scheduled for an October release, is an adaptation of Maurice Sendak's 1963 children's picture book.
